My client wants me to replicate an INFO shared folder across his WAN (4 sites). The I: drive at each site has a number of business documents (Word, Excel, Powerpoint) that should be available to all users.
I have set up a timed event (each 2:00am) that does an XCOPY /D of the files (and folders) in the \\server\Info folder to the \\Office1\Info, \\Office2\Info, \\Office3\Info folders.
This has worked a treat till now, but he has now decided he may want to:
A) Remove a file
B) Rename a file (XCOPY leaves the old filename existing and copies the new one)
C) Move a file to another INFO folder (XCOPY ends up with the file in both folders).
I don't think that XCOPY can cover the above processes and wonder if Kix is a solution.
Please offer thoughts...
